* The Fresh Fruit Quality Option is a critical piece of the Apple Policy in
New England. The Basic Policy calculates losses on the percentage of fresh
or processing apple production that fails to grade U.S. No.1 Processing or
better. The Quality Option calculates losses on Fresh Apple production that
fails to grade U.S. Fancy or better. The Fresh Apple Quality Option
adjusts Fresh Production losses on a sliding scale from 20% to 65%. When
65% of the total production fails to grade U.S. Fancy a total loss is paid.
*
*New England is primarily a Fresh Market region and the dollar value of our
Fresh Market Apples is higher than most markets in the U.S. Changes to the
Fresh Quality Option could have a major impact on the benefits of the Apple
Policy. *
